Olympus Mju III 110
The Olympus Mju III 110 is a compact 35mm film camera from the Mju (µ) series, sold in the late 1990s and early 2000s as a pocketable point-and-shoot with a zoom lens. It sat in the consumer end of Olympus's compact film range.
Evidence on what an Olympus Mju III 110 is worth today is thin: a single recorded UK auction hammer result from August 2024 sold for £50, which represents a wholesale saleroom level rather than a retail asking price. With only one data point it is not safe to quote a meaningful range or median, and the price a clean working example sells for can vary with cosmetic condition and whether the original case is included.
